Author Biography



Esmeralda Santiago is the eldest of eleven children. She spent her childhood in Puerto Rico, moving back and forth between a tiny village and Santurce, a suburb of San Juan. With her mother and siblings she moved to New York in 1961, at the age of thirteen. She attended junior high school in Brooklyn, and Performing Arts High School in Manhattan. After the extraordinary years described in her two memoirs, When I Was Puerto Rican and Almost a Woman, she graduated from Harvard University and received a master's degree from Sarah Lawrence College. Santiago is also the author of América's Dream and is coeditor, with Joie Davidow, of Las Christmas: Favorite Latino Authors Share Their Holiday Memories. Santiago lives in Westchester County, New York, with her husband and two children.
